MOOCs and Open Education Around the World. Routledge (2015).
Edited by Curtis J. Bonk, Mimi M. Lee, Thomas C. Reeves, Thomas H. Reynolds.

MOOCs and Open Education is a
edited collection
which
addresses
topics
related to open
education resources
(OER) and
massive open online courses (MOOC).
The latest
gains in
blended learning technology are enabling
learners
in every nation on earth
to take courses via the Internet.
These online MOOC courses are
almost always free
for students but do not
always
lead to formal accreditation.

This book answers many questions about MOOCs and other forms of open education.
How can we
make sure that
the quality of these
MOOC courses is
satisfactory?
How can learners
be assured that
lecturers are properly credentialed
to teach online classes?
What business strategies are being used by
organizations like
The Pennsylvania State University to conduct these massively open online courses?
What evaluation strategies and teaching practices are optimal?
How can educators
deal with
low
motivation and high
learner attrition?
